As technology advances in different sub-domains of computing, data-driven 
models are becoming increasingly important. The data-dependent world now faces 
many challenges in terms of data accuracy and data privacy. High-impact 
advancements include machine learning, artificial intelligence, deep learning 
and many more. Data is growing exponentially in terms of diversity and 
complexity. One organization or industry processes over a few million 
transactions per hour and stores hundreds of billions of data. We live in a 
world with a great need for more efficient data analysis and processing. Data 
analytics can reveal hidden patterns, complex relationships, internal 
information relations, and even segmentation. Data applications have opened up 
new possibilities in every aspect of our lives. Studying data and its 
structure, dynamics, and modern data technologies is ongoing. There is a great 
deal of literature and research on data management, but it does not address the 
data processing needs. Many studies focus on developing models and systems for 
analyzing large datasets.

Data analysis leads to application domains that have a systematic impact on 
decisions. The knowledge gained from the data analysis enables the generation 
of critical information for multiple domains. In this conference, we review and 
discuss the latest trends in data management, the opportunities and challenges, 
and how they have affected organizations' ability to develop effective business 
and technology strategies and stay up-to-date in data technology. We also 
highlight current open research directions in data analytics that need further 
attention.
